From weddings to birthdays, graduations to holidays, the possibilities for car decor are as limitless as your imagination. Start with simple accessories like window markers, magnetic signs, or themed flags for easy-to-remove options. For more elaborate ideas, consider flower arrangements on the bumper, balloon arches, or LED light strips to make your vehicle shine, especially during evening celebrations. You can also use garlands, streamers, and ribbons in color schemes that match the event, ensuring your car becomes an extension of your creative vision.Tips 1:As a designer, my advice is to make sure your car decorations are not just beautiful but functional—consider sightlines, secure attachment methods, and materials that won’t damage your vehicle’s finish.
